Sustaining Civil Society: Economic Change, Democracy, and the Social Construction of Citizenship in Latin America Philip Oxhorn
Sustaining Civil Society: Economic Change, Democracy, and the Social Construction of Citizenship in Latin America
Philip Oxhorn
Oxhorn studies the process by which social groups are incorporated into national socioeconomic and political development through an approach that focuses on the “social construction of citizenship.” He sets forth a theory of civil society adequate for explaining current developments in a way that such controversial neoconservative theories cannot.
